The AM-5G20-90 airMAX 2x2 MIMO BaseStation Sector Antenna from Ubiquiti Networks is designed to seamlessly integrate with RocketM radios (sold separately). By pairing the RocketM radio with the antenna’s reach, a powerful base station can be created. This combination gives network architects flexibility and convenience.
Unlike standard Wi-Fi protocol, Time Division Multiple Access (TDMA) airMAX protocol allows each client to send and receive data using pre-designated time slots scheduled by an intelligent AP controller. This time slot method eliminates hidden node collisions and maximizes airtime efficiency. It provides many magnitudes of performance improvements in latency, throughput, and scalability compared to all other outdoor systems.

Frequency Range 5.15 to 5.85 GHz
Gain 19.4 to 20.3 dBi
Hpol Beamwidth 91° (6 dB)
Vpol Beamwidth 85° (6 dB)
Beamwidth Electrical: 4°
Electrical Downtilt 2°
VSWR (Voltage Standing Wave Ratio) 1.5:1
Wind Survivability 125 mph
Wind Loading 26 lbf @ 100 mph
Polarization Dual-Linear
Cross-pol Isolation 28 dB Min
ETSI Specification EN 302 326 DN2
Mounting Universal Pole Mount, RocketM Bracket, and Weatherproof RF Jumpers Included
Dimensions 27.55 x 5.31 x 2.75" (700 x 135 x 70 mm)
Weight 13 lb (5.9 kg)
